Although these shoes fit well and are very comfortable and bought them because I work in healthcare and am pretty much on my feet for the bulk of my 10 hour workday, I cannot reccommend due to one glaring issue: They Squeak! (Well, at least the left one does...)
I do not know if this is a particular manufacturing issue and/or related to them being the non-slip version of the Bondi or my gait (i have no issues with my gait or stride). The squeak is with every step and is very loud, even on carpet. So loud that people turn to find where the squeaking noise is coming from and I found myself becoming self-conscious about it and started to walk on the outside edge of my left foot so the noise (and unwanted attention) would go away. After a day or two my left foot began to hurt from not walking "normally".
I plan on returning these and try another pair (I really want the non-slip for use in the hospital) to find out if it was a one-off issue.
